Problem

In conditional handover (CHO) procedures, inefficient resource utilization occurs due to early or unnecessary preparation of target cells, leading to wasted resources and suboptimal handover decisions, as existing systems lack sufficient feedback mechanisms to adjust preparation policies based on resource utilization costs across different radio nodes.

Innovation Solution

Implementing a mechanism where target radio nodes provide cost feedback to source nodes on resource utilization, allowing for policy adjustments to optimize CHO preparation timing and reduce resource wastage, using machine learning algorithms to evaluate and adjust CHO policies based on received cost information.

Data Source

PatentUS11516708B1Information exchange through the interfaces for ML-based CHO
Publication Date: 2022.11.29 NOKIA TECHNOLOGIES OY

AI summary

An apparatus includes circuitry configured to: initiate a conditional handover preparation for a conditional handover to change communication access for a user equipment from a source node to a target node; receive a cost from the target node following the conditional handover preparation; receive a cause indicating a trigger for sending the cost, an indication of a type of the cost, and a range for the cost, where the cause characterizes a value of the cost to indicate the type of the cost; the cost being based on resource utilization of the target node, the resource utilization being related to providing communication access for the user equipment following the conditional handover preparation; and adjust a policy related to an initiation of a subsequent conditional handover preparation for the user equipment to the target node, the policy adjusted based on the cost to enhance the resource utilization of the target node.
